Smart Sand, Inc. Form 8-K Summary
Business Context and Reporting Period
Smart Sand, Inc. (SND) filed a Current Report on Form 8-K dated September 3, 2024. The filing discloses the entry into a new material definitive agreement and the termination of a prior credit facility to restructure the company's short-term liquidity arrangements.
Key Financial Metrics and Debt Structure
- New Facility: Entered into a five-year senior secured asset-based credit facility (ABL Credit Facility) with a maximum principal amount of $30.0 million.
- Utilization: Approximately $1.0 million was drawn at closing, leaving $29.0 million available under the initial borrowing base.
- Interest Rate: Borrowings bear interest at SOFR plus an applicable margin of 2.75%.
- Collateral: Secured by a first-priority security interest in eligible inventory and accounts receivable. Owned real estate and sand reserves are explicitly excluded from the collateral.
- Covenants: Includes restrictions on liens, indebtedness, and asset dispositions. Requires a minimum fixed charge coverage ratio of 1.1 to 1.0 in certain limited circumstances.
Material Changes Versus Prior Period
The company terminated its existing senior secured asset-based credit facility (Prior Credit Facility) dated December 13, 2019. The Prior Facility had a maximum principal amount of $20.0 million and was scheduled to mature on December 13, 2024. The new facility increases the total available credit capacity by $10.0 million and extends the maturity date by approximately four years.
Outlook, Risks, and Management Commentary
The filing does not provide specific forward-looking guidance, management commentary on operational outlook, or discussion of unusual items beyond the debt restructuring. The primary risk disclosed relates to compliance with the new facility's covenants, including the fixed charge coverage ratio and restrictions on additional indebtedness or asset dispositions.
